The Kenya National Association of the Deaf (KNAD) is a legal Non- Governmental Organization (NGO).
The organization was registered in 1987 with the government of Kenya under the Registrar of Societies
Act of 1968 rule 4. Its membership is derived from affiliated regional association with members drawn
from the grassroots Deaf community country wide. From its humble inception and membership drive,
KNAD has since demonstrated excellent and a unique capacity to promote human rights of deaf people
through the use of Kenyan Sign language and contributed as effectively as possible to the establishment
of a society that respects human dignity, social justice and equal opportunity for Deaf Persons in Kenya.
